canuck
29-Sep-07, 08:54
"canuck" is one of those terms of endearment which Canadians sometimes apply to themselves. If you live in the East it comes from a Quebecois word for Canada, but it you live in the West it is a form of the native word "Chinook" the warm, wild winds that sweep down from the mountains.

It seemed a good name for me when I was moving to Caithness in 2004 and has just stayed with me since then.
